Epoxy is the family of basic components or cured end products of epoxy resins, also known as polyepoxides, a class of reactive prepolymers and polymers which contain epoxide groups. The epoxide functional group is also collectively called epoxy. [1] The IUPAC name for an epoxide group is an oxirane.

What is Epoxy? Epoxy is a versatile thermosetting polymer used extensively for adhesives, protective coatings, and high-strength composite materials. Industrial sectors value the substance for its ability to transition from a liquid state to a permanent solid through a chemical reaction.
